Transaction 70c659633ff239e702a1c3d0c1b459d819cbdddb964200cb34005c8f9a0c93e6
1 Input
1 Output
-
70c659633ff239e702a1c3d0c1b459d819cbdddb964200cb34005c8f9a0c93e6:0
- value
- 2666905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0679c68645003650df1dc7ab2692af2a51cc20e0 OP_EQUAL
- address
- 32HFroaRobpxiAkWsFSzwh3n1i3DiTyLCD